Mr. Ishman Woodard's Obituary

Ishman Worth Woodard, Sr. He quietly and peacefully departed this earthly life on Thursday, December 28, 2023 at his residence in Walkertown, North Carolina. Ishman graduated from Darden High School in Wilson, NC in 1960. He was drafted and served in the Army from 1962-1964. He then attended and graduated from Wilson Technical Institute, Wilson, NC and Fayetteville Technical Community College, Fayetteville, NC in 1968 where he received a degree as a Tool and Dye Maker. He gave his life to God at an early age and became a member. of Rountree Missionary Baptist Church, Wilson NC, where he was ordained as a deacon at the age of 27. Ishman sought employment in his trade which he acquired in Winston Salem, North Carolina in 1969 where he began his career with AMP Inc. When he began his life in a new city, he also joined Mars Hill Missionary Baptist Church under the leadership of Rev. W. E. Samuels and continued his labor as a deacon, trustee, and Sunday School Superintendent. Ishman possessed a melodious bass voice and raised it in song in many choirs in Wilson, Charlotte, and Winston Salem, NC. While employed by AMP Inc. Ishman was afforded the opportunity to travel to destinations such as Singapore, Puerto Rico, and Mexico. AMP was purchased by Tyco International and after nearly thirty years of employment, he retired in 1998. Ishman enjoyed many hobbies such as photography, fishing, and bowling. He often had a camera in his hands and loved sharing photos with family and friends. If you wanted an instant smile or great conversation with Ishman, all you had to do was speak with him about fishing. He thoroughly enjoyed deep sea fishing, and he loved sharing the fish that he caught with friends and loved ones. His other hobby was bowling where he was a member of the Salty Crew team at Creekside Bowling Lanes.
